Product Description

These reversed-phase columns contain Waters patented embedded polar group technology that “shields” the silica’ residual silanol surface from highly basic analytes. The reduced silanol activity for the SymmetryShield RP18 column significantly improves peak shape and resolution.

Specifications
Chemistry: C18
Separation Mode: Reversed Phase
Particle Substrate: Silica
pH Range Min: 2 pH
pH Range Max: 8 pH
Maximum Pressure: 6000 psi (415 Bar)
Endcapped: Yes
Bonding Technology: Shield RP18
Silanol Activity: Low
Particle Shape: Spherical
Particle Size: 5 µm
Endfitting Type: Waters
Pore Size: 100 Å
Format: Column
Surface Area: 335
System: HPLC
USP Classification: L1
Inner Diameter: 3 mm
Length: 250 mm
Carbon Load: 17 %
UNSPSC: 41115709
Brand: Symmetry
Product Type: Columns
Units per Package: 1 pk

Additional Information
Symmetry Shield RP18 Column, 100Å, 5 µm, 3 mm X 250 mm, 1/pk The Symmetry Shield RP18 Column provides improved peak form over a wide pH range. Because of its high bonding density and low residual silanol activity of packing materials, the analytical column can handle a wide pH range. This means you can optimize your technique by working at neutral or low pH without sacrificing the peak shape. By giving lower levels of detection and quantitation, the lab equipment will also assist you in developing new techniques faster and increasing laboratory productivity. These reversed-phase columns contain Waters' patented embedded polar group technology that "shields" the silica' residual silanol surface from highly basic analytes. The reduced silanol activity for the SymmetryShield RP18 column significantly improves peak shape and resolution. The Symmetry Shield RP18 Column is built to last and will help you cut the cost of lab equipment. This is because the Symmetry Shield RP18 Column provides optimal performance and a combination of two key aspects that influence the column's lifetime: the packing material's hydrolytic stability and the packed bed's mechanical stability. Ultra-pure reagents are used in a cGMP, ISO 9001 certified facility, each batch of Symmetry Shield RP18 Column's packing material is chromatographically tested with acidic, basic, and neutral analytes, with results held within narrow specification ranges to ensure outstanding, repeatable performance. With the Symmetry Shield RP18 Column, you can avail the use of the strength of tight specification ranges to achieve remarkable reproducibility. The lab equipment has the industry's smallest ligand surface coverage (ligand density). This assures minimum resolution shifts and, as a result, more repeatable outcomes from batch to batch and column to column. Waters also offers lab equipment that helps to protect your analytical column from contaminants that hurt the column and impair your results, such as the Symmetry Shield RP18 VanGuard Cartridge, 100Å, 5 µm, 2.1 mm X 5 mm, 3/pk. The cartridge is made using the exact packing materials that are present in the column, making them ideally suited to work together.

FAQ
What Is The Pressure That The Symmetry Shield RP18 Column Can Tolerate? The Symmetry Shield RP18 Column listed here can easily sustain up to 6000 psi (415 Bar) pressure, given that the temperature and pH limits are also observed.
